Default Rollout???

What is rollout?

I have used the iphone app 'Gear-it' to calculate the roll out for my b4 and it is 0.62, is this good? What number should i be aiming at??

Rollout is the distance your car travels per 1 full roll of the tyres circumference. so for your car - every time the pinion makes 1 rotation, the car travels 0.62 inches.

Its for people running on-road with foam tyres - as the tyres wear down and get smaller in diameter, you need to gear up to keep the rollout the same.

Because rubber tyres stay the same, don't worry about it.
